A light earthquake magnitude 4.3 (ml/mb) has occurred on Sunday, 205 km WNW of Panguna, Papua New Guinea (127 miles). The 4.3-magnitude earthquake was detected at 07:16:53 / 7:16 am (local time epicenter). Event id: us7000rfk7. Ids that are associated to the earthquake: us7000rfk7. A tsunami warning has not been issued (Does not indicate if a tsunami actually did or will exist). The epicenter was at a depth of 17.876 km (11 miles). Exact location, longitude 153.7053° East, latitude -5.7781° South, depth = 17.876 km. Exact time and date of event in UTC/GMT: 16/11/25 / 2025-11-16 07:16:53 / November 16, 2025 @ 7:16 am.
Every year there are an estimated 13,000 light earthquakes in the world. Earthquakes 4.0 to 5.0 are often felt, but only causes minor damage. In the past 24 hours, there have been two, in the last 10 days five, in the past 30 days seven and in the last 365 days fifty-four earthquakes of magnitude 3.0 or greater that have been detected in the same area.
